Great burly Scotsman Brian Cox continues his (welcome) campaign to appear in every third movie in production.

The former Lecter is now part of TELL-TALE, the contemporary version of Edgar Allen Poe’s macabre (and rather brief) murder story “The Tell-Tale Heart”. The movie, from director Michael Cuesta (DEXTER, SIX FEET UNDER), stars Josh Lucas as a heart transplant recipient compelled by his new pumper to seek revenge on the donor’s killer(s). So, creative license, then.

Cox will play “the old cop, like the Morgan Freeman part in SEVEN who comes in and tries to solve the case,” and says that he’ll be investigating “how this surgeon is finding body parts and bumping people off.” The movie comes from Tony and Ridley Scott’s production company Scott Free, with a script intriguingly described as “JACOB’S LADDER meets MARATHON MAN.”
